Let us begin with something really easy, changing the actual light bulbs. Do this for the whole house, not merely the kitchen. The typical light bulbs are the incandescent style, which really should be replaced with compact fluorescent lightbulbs, which save energy. They cost a little bit more in the beginning, but they last ten times longer, and use a lesser amount of electricity. One of the pluses is that for every one of these lightbulbs used, it signifies that approximately ten normal lightbulbs less will end up at a landfill site. The ingredients needed to make Orange Sauce for Duck a l’Orange:
  1. You need 3 tablespoons sugar
  2. You need 1/4 cup red wine vinegar
  3. Take 2 cups duck stock (I made my own with duck giblets and bones)
  4. You need 2 sweet orange juiced
  5. You need 1 tablespoon corn starch
  6. Use 3 tablespoons Grand Marnier
Steps to make Orange Sauce for Duck a l’Orange:
  1. Boil the vinegar and sugar in a small pot until it turns brown. Pour in the stock little by little, stirring all the while.
  2. Bring it to a simmer, then add about 1/2 cup of orange juice and the large bits of peel. Simmer 5 minutes. Whisk corn starch in till sauce thickens. Add the Grand Marnier and enough salt to taste.
